Join Phyllis Theroux, author of The Journal Keeper, for a seminar on how to keep a journal you will treasure. There are rules. She will share them. There are rewards. She will take you through a few mock journal-keeping sessions that will help you uncover those rewards on the spot. But the deepest reward is cumulative. The habit of pausing each day to record one’s thoughts and observations leads to a more thoughtful, observant life, and hooks one on the habit of journal-keeping forever.

Phyllis Theroux began her career in Washington, D.C. writing essays for the Washington Post and the New York Times. That segued into a memoir, which led to a career as an author, columnist, and teacher. As the founder of Nightwriters, she is currently working on a biography of her late mother, who was the inspiration for many of her essays. She lives with her husband, Ragan Phillips, in Ashland, Virginia.
